Introduction

Newton's Playground is a sandbox game based on physics. Players can use different items and interact with the environment to complete goals, with a lot of freedom to create and cause chaos.

Main Missions

Office Revenge Mission

Goal: Find and get revenge on your boss, Phil, who fired you.

Steps:

  1. Use a sledgehammer to break office equipment.
  2. When you find Phil, throw him out the window.
  3. Watch out for guards—fight them with your fists or weapons.

Convenience Store Robbery

Goal: Get money after losing your job.

Steps:

  1. Use an RC car with a spear to distract the guard.
  2. Tame a dog: aim the bone remote at an NPC's head and press the button to make the dog follow you.
  3. Break the cash register, but note: the staff will fight back (no real money is rewarded).

Key Game Features

Physics-Based Interactions

  • Flying Bathtub: Attach thrusters to a bathtub and press the button to fly.
  • Helicopter Man: Grab the character with a propeller and press the button to lift off (control carefully).

Train Derailment Methods

  • Method 1: Place explosive barrels on the tracks, but keep a safe distance.
  • Method 2: Landmines work better—they derail the train when it runs over them.
  • Easter Egg: Grabbing the moving train by hand can also derail it, but may cause bugs.

Pet Dog System

Use the bone remote on an NPC's head—press the button to make the dog follow you (press occasionally to keep it following).

Tips & Tricks

  • Useful Weapons: Physics gun, baseball bat, frying pan.
  • Stealth: Use the RC car to distract enemies.
  • Destroy Objects: You can break shelves and furniture, but there's no reward.
  • Boss Hint: The guy named Phil on the office calendar is not the real boss.

Important Notes

  • Explosive barrels are hard to detonate—use landmines instead.
  • After derailing the train, your character may get stuck—reload if needed.
  • The pet dog may get stuck; press the remote button again to reset.
